Time to post to prove that I am still alive, I suppose.
For 2015, the return was 12.98%.
For the first half year of 2016 , the return was only 1.5%. I know it is not good but there are two footnotes.
1. There were several missed trades because of IB data issues (data missing or wrong data). If there were no data issues, the return would be 4%-5% for the first half year. I rewrote my program to work around the problems but occasionally still experienced them. May have to experiment with other data providers.
2. The market in the first half was really hard to trade, which I think had something to do the rate hike last year and the expected hikes (or lack of) in the future.
Strategy wise, I still stuck to the same group of strategies that I used last year, but added two new ones at the beginning of this year. I also experimented with the Hong Kong index futures but quit it after a small loss.